Transaction 3434ec025301513372ac4b2668a575a4a2de6ecf9a345f585633f7414c5f1d4c
1 Input
1 Output
-
3434ec025301513372ac4b2668a575a4a2de6ecf9a345f585633f7414c5f1d4c:0
- value
- 491005
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d8989661aca622fbb94abc5d5da086baea561d1
- address
- bc1q9kycjes6ef3zlwu540zatksgdwh22cw3zdjkl9